Autumn in central Massachusetts is a season that feels almost custom made for scenic drives and quiet hikes. The annual turning of the leaves, known to many as “leaf peeping,” draws visitors from far and wide to revel in the explosion of reds, yellows, and oranges that blanket the rolling hills and forests around Amherst. Planning your route can make the experience memorable and also allows you to pair it seamlessly with a convenient dispensary visit.
Leaf peeping refers to the activity of traveling to view and photograph the vibrant colors of fall foliage, especially in New England, where the spectacle is particularly fleeting and beautiful. For many, it’s a reason to slow down and appreciate the seasonal shift. The best color typically peaks in the Pioneer Valley from late September through mid-October, but even a casual afternoon drive can reveal layers of fiery hues lining rural roads and quiet campus pathways.
